Tryouts are necessary for league placement and to help in drafting teams with equal talent.
All players who register for McLean Little League will be placed on a team. However, registrations postmarked after the closing date will be accepted with a late fee, but players will be placed on a waiting list.
Managers will draft players immediately following the tryouts.
Please note: if you mail in your registration, and a tryout is required, it is your responsibility to contact the league to schedule a tryout.
2010 BASEBALL
Baseball players ages 9-12 who are not currently on a Majors team MUST try out.
At the tryout players will be asked to:
(1) do a timed run of 60 feet. Bases are 60 feet apart in Little League.
(2) field 3-5 ground balls and throw the ball to an individual standing 50-80 feet away.
(3) field 3-5 pop ups and throws the ball to an individual standing 50-80 feet away
(4) attempt to bunt 1 to 2 pitches
(5) then 5-7 swings from a pitching machine.
Baseball try-outs are scheduled by age. Please be prepared to sign up for a specific try out date and time at registration.
Please arrive ten minutes before your scheduled evaluation time. Evaluations should take no more than one hour.
Bats and batting helmets will be available. However, players are urged to bring their own glove, bat and batting helmet. Also please make sure players wear sneakers (NO CLEATS).
